The rap clip “Freedom or Death” released by the Baku Initiative Group (BIG) on March 13 has sparked significant controversy in French political circles.
Axar.az reports that various French media outlets have already published reports on the issue.
The lyrics of the rap “Liberté ou Mort”, along with photos depicting events of 2024, have been classified as incitement to violence and hatred, prompting an official investigation.
New Caledonia’s prosecutor, Yves Dupas, has decided to transfer the case to the Paris court.
